In 1747 , Antoine-Claude Maille opened his first shop on rue Saint-André-des-Arts in Paris and had a parchment published that signed the official birth certificate of Maille mustards: “The public is warned that Maille has the secrets for the distillation of vinegars and manufacture of mustards “. In 1752 , he became official supplier of the court of Hungary before landing the arms of the King of France in 1769 , then those of Catherine II of Russia in 1771 . The gourmet Grimod de la Reynière designates him as the “first mustard man of Europe”.

Composition

Specialty Dijon mustard and spices
71% Dijon mustard (water, MUSTARD seeds, alcohol vinegar, salt, citric acid acidifier, preservative E224 (SULFITES)), sunflower oil, water, white wine, honey, blue poppy seeds 1%, spices 0 , 7%, modified starch, MUSTARD flour, stabilizer xanthan gum, salt.
